Summary of the Conference Call on Sanitation Automation Industry Industry Overview - The conference focused on the sanitation automation industry, particularly the adoption of unmanned sanitation equipment and its economic viability [1][2][3]. Key Points and Arguments 1. Economic Viability of Small Tonnage Equipment: - Small tonnage equipment is highlighted as having stronger economic feasibility and is approaching a high cost-performance stage [2]. - Companies such as Fulongma, Jinglv Environment, Qiaoyin Co., and Yuhua Tian are identified as having significant sanitation service revenue, which contributes to their performance elasticity [2]. 2. Employment Impact: - The transition to automation in sanitation may create short-term employment pressures, particularly for low-income labor groups [3]. - Long-term trends indicate that aging populations will lead to a labor shortage in the sanitation sector, necessitating automation [4]. 3. Market Size and Growth: - The total market size for sanitation equipment is estimated to be around 200 billion, with significant growth potential as automation adoption increases [5]. - The industry is expected to see a 130% growth rate in the coming year, driven by policy support in major cities like Guangzhou and Shenzhen [6]. 4. Types of Unmanned Equipment: - Three categories of unmanned sanitation equipment are discussed: small tonnage cleaning devices, L4 level unmanned sanitation vehicles, and humanoid robots for sanitation tasks [10][11][12]. - The economic analysis indicates that small tonnage devices can replace 2-3 workers, achieving cost parity within 3-4 years [12][24]. 5. Market Dynamics: - The market is characterized by a fragmented landscape with significant participation from sanitation service companies, equipment manufacturers, and technology firms [18][19]. - Government-led initiatives are prevalent, with many cities implementing policies to promote the use of unmanned sanitation equipment [16][17]. 6. Future Projections: - The market for small tonnage unmanned devices is projected to reach approximately 575 billion, while L4 level vehicles could reach 761 billion, indicating a combined market potential exceeding 1 trillion [15]. - The report anticipates that small tonnage equipment will lead the market in the next 1-2 years due to its economic advantages [28]. Additional Important Insights - The aging workforce in sanitation services is a critical factor driving the need for automation [4][5]. - The report emphasizes the importance of policy support in facilitating the adoption of unmanned sanitation technologies [16][17]. - Companies are encouraged to leverage technological advancements to enhance operational efficiency and reduce costs [27][28].
